    Theodore Wafer, the Dearborn, Michigan resident who shot and killed 19-year-old Renisha McBride because she crashed her car and knocked on his door at 4:00 AM asking for an ambulance, was sentenced today for 15-30 years in prison for his second-degree murder conviction as well as an additional 2 years for the illegal use of a gun.
